The Newest on the block.............This is a long scale (670mm) -(26 3\8 in.), and has the exterior dimensions of
the Belleville. This is where the likeness ends. Inside this guitar sits an interior soundbox and reflector, the likes of which have never been seen before.
Configured to work on the long scale
model. the reflector part of the inside box can be seen as the curved, striped piece in the soundhole.
This instrument has the long string length prefered by many guitarists coupled with the quick and loud
response of the Mystery Pacific with its interior box.
If the original interior soundbox design by Maccaferri could be called �stage one�, and my Mystery Pacific soundbox which is very different called
�stage two�, Then this would be a �stage three� design making this instrument the most sophisticated gypsy guitar design on the planet.
Its back and sides are of Honduras rosewood with a spruce or cedar
soundboard. The parallelogram purfling around the top is optional......
